Q3 Planning Note — Heads of Department

Quick heads-up: Veldrane Systems sent over their term sheet for the Lattice co-sell deal late Friday. Terms look better than expected, though the exclusivity clause needs work. Marta's team is reviewing this week and we'll discuss at Thursday's planning session. Before then, please read the summary below carefully.

internal memo for hahaf-kahof: Only 39 of the 428 pilot accounts renewed Sorion, so a churn review is set for April 12. Praokix Freight is in early talks to buy Queniusox Group for about $145.8 million.

Subject: ParcelPing webhook cut-over — complete

Hi on-call,

The cut-over of the ParcelPing tracking webhook to the new dispatcher finished at 02:10 local. Old endpoints are drained; retries from the legacy queue flushed cleanly. Watch delivery latency for the next 24 hours and page the Brindle team if failures exceed 1%. For reference during the watch window, the dispatcher's active configuration is reproduced below.

deployment values, yadug-bawif:
[framir]
team = pelox
access_code = ac_a38ab2
owner = tamion.julael
host = framir.tolvaqlabs.test
port = 11211
peer = tammir.zemvargrid.local
salt = 2215ef03
pin = 1541

TURN-208: Gatevale turnstile counters at the Merrow Field pilot double-count when a rotation reverses mid-cycle. Attendance totals drift roughly 2% high per event. The debounce window fix is implemented, reviewed by Ilsa, and soak-tested across two simulated match days without drift. Ready for your cut; the candidate build is identified below.

trace token, tagag-tafog: htk6_5ed18c